GCN Circular 22144

Subject
GRB 171120A: Swift/UVOT Upper Limits

J. D. Gropp (PSU) and A. Tohuvavohu (PSU)
report on behalf of the Swift/UVOT team:

The Swift/UVOT began settled observations of the field of GRB 171120A
99 s after the BAT trigger (Tohuvavohu et al., GCN Circ. 22133).
No optical afterglow consistent with the refined XRT position
(Evans et al. GCN Circ. 22135)
is detected in the initial UVOT exposures.
Preliminary 3-sigma upper limits using the UVOT photometric system
(Breeveld et al. 2011, AIP Conf. Proc. 1358, 373) for the first
finding chart (FC) exposure and subsequent exposures are:

Filter         T_start(s)   T_stop(s)      Exp(s)         Mag

white_FC            99          249          147         >19.9
u_FC               311          561          246         >19.7
white               99         5989          560         >21.1
v                  640         6399          413         >19.1
b                  566         5784          413         >20.9
u                  311        11713          811         >20.7
w1                5174        11532         1082         >21.0
m2                9724        10624          886         >21.0
w2                4559         6194          393         >21.0

The magnitudes in the table are not corrected for the Galactic extinction
due to the reddening of E(B-V) = 0.02 in the direction of the burst
(Schlegel et al. 1998).
